About

A rice-and-yeast ferment (sake lees) loved in Japanese skincare for its smoothing, slightly brightening effect. Generally gentle; complex composition limits hard claims.

Function

SKIN CONDITIONING - EMOLLIENT

Skin benefits

  • Skin smoothing
  • Mild brightening
  • Humectant

Known concerns

  • Aspergillus metabolite variability
  • Possible mild sensitization
  • Limited dossier
